    A little after midnight on Friday, June 7, a 42-year-old man placed a camera bag with equipment behind a chair in a bar on Amsterdam Avenue. He left the bar about an hour later, forgetting his property. He returned to the bar in the morning to ask if anyone had found his property, but the only item found was his camera bag -- now empty. Items stolen included a Nikon D5000 valued at $1,200; a Nikon Af-S DX lens costing $950; miscellaneous camera equipment valued at $100; and memory cards worth $50. In total the man's forgetful night set him back $2,300.
